Flat 1, 118 Marine Parade, Brighton, BN2 1DD is a leasehold flat built before 1900. The property offers approximately 581 square feet of living space and is situated on the 1st floor. In this location, apartments of similar size usually have one bedroom.
The estimated current market value of the property is £345,785 , which equates to approximately £595 per square foot. It was last sold on 15 Jan 2016 for £276,050. Since then, the value has increased by £69,735, representing a 25.3% increase, or approximately 2.5% per year.

Flat 1, 118 Marine Parade, Brighton, Brighton And Hove, East Sussex, BN2 1DD has an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) rating of E, based on the latest assessment carried out on 2 Oct 2024.
This property uses electric room heaters as its main heating source. Hot water is provided from off-peak electric immersion heater. The windows are single glazed.
The previous EPC assessment was conducted on 20 Feb 2010, when the property was rated D. The current rating of E reflects a decline in energy efficiency of 3.6%.
